XXX [DVD](2002) DVD Vin Diesel cements his screen action hero status with this adrenaline-pumping spy adventure refueled for Generation Y audiences. In trouble with the law, extreme sports enthusiast Diesel is recruited by National Security Agency honcho Samuel L. Jackson to stop a former Russian soldier out to terrorize the world with biochemical weapons. Sent to Prague, Diesel calls on his skills in motorcycling, mountain-climbing, skiboarding and more to snag his man. With Asia Argento, Marton Csokas; directed by Rob Cohen ("The Fast and the Furious"). 124 min. Phantom Of The Opera(1998) VHS One of the all-time classic suspense stories is given a lavish rendition by Eurohorror auteur Dario Argento. Julian Sands stars as the twisted-in-body-and-soul denizen of the catacombs beneath the Paris Opera House, and Asia Argento is the beautiful singer who becomes his overwhelming obsession. With Andrea Di Stefano, Zoltan Barabas. 100 min.
Scarlet Diva [DVD](2000) DVD A stylized chronicle of a young woman's descent into disillusionment, decadence and despair, Asia Argento's ("XXX") debut as writer/director/star finds her in the semi-autobiographical role of a young actress whose success is tempered by a stormy family life, graphic episodes of sex and drugs, and a globe-hopping quest for true love. With Jean Shepard, Herbert Fritsch and, as her mother, Argento's real-life mother, Daria Nicolodi. 91 min. Demons 2 [DVD](1986) DVD What begins as an ordinary birthday party in a typical urban apartment building soon becomes a nightmare when hellish creatures appear from a TV set showing a horror film. Tenants are attacked, a dog turns into a zombie canine, and director Lamberto Bava shocks and impresses with his stunning technique. Dario Argento production stars Bobby Rhodes, Asia Argento. 91 min. Palombella Rossa(1989) VHS The funniest movie to ever mix water polo, amnesia and Italian Communism, writer/director/star Nanni Moretti's surrealistic farce follows a high-ranking politician who loses his memory during a water polo game and attempts to regain it...without leaving the swimming pool. With Silvio Orlando, Asia Argento. 87 min. In Italian with English subtitles.
Queen Margot [DVD](1994) DVD Set in France during the late 16th-century conflict between the Catholics and Protestant Huguenots, this acclaimed historical drama stars Isabelle Adjani as the daughter of Queen Mother Catherine de Medici who is forced into marriage with her Protestant cousin. The union leads to conflict and, eventually, the St. Bartholomew's Day Massacre. With Daniel Auteuil, Vincent Perez, Virna Lisi & Asia Argento. 144 min. In French with English subtitles.
The Stendhal Syndrome(1996) VHS In Dario Argento's disturbing shocker, daughter Asia Argento is a sex crimes unit policewoman trying to track down a serial rapist in Italy. While at Florence's famed Uffizi museum, she falls victim to an illness that causes severe hallucinations. Upon recovery, she realizes that she has been raped by the man she is pursuing. With Thomas Kretschmann; music by Ennio Morricone. 101 min.
Traveling Companion(1996) VHS Shattering Italian drama stars Asia Argento as a beautiful but unstable teen hired to look after a rich woman's senile father. Following the old man as he aimlessly travels throughout Italy, Argento learns about herself while encountering a variety of fascinating men and attempting to foil her brother's plot to kidnap her ward. Michel Piccoli, Lino Capolicchio co-star. 104 min. In Italian with English subtitles.
New Rose Hotel(1998) VHS In this mind-bending treatment of William Gibson's cyberpunk thriller, business mercenary Christopher Walken teams with Willem Dafoe in a kidnapping scheme involving the kidnapping of a Japanese scientist. When Dafoe falls in love with the hooker they hire to seduce the scientist, their plans goes awry and their lives are endangered. Annabella Sciorra also stars in this Abel Ferrara ("King of New York") production that's loaded with weird visuals and kinky sex. Also stars Asia Argento. 93 min.
